Flash staff pulls magazine together Editor-in Chief: John Ursu Associate Editor: Brooks Rogers Literary Advisor: Will Fisher Fiction Editors: Romi Mann Geoff Watson Poetry Editors: Cameron Fitzsimmons Melanie Zurek Art Editors: Bob Piper Steve Green Cover Editor: Greta Canton Photo Editor: Greta Canton Layout Editors: Roger Erny Rico Irizarry Literary Advisor: Will Fisher Artistic Advisor: Bob Teslow Assistants: Eric Priest Anne Ursu Molly Kathy Utter McKenna Erin Frankenberry Melanie Bearse The 1987-88 Flash staff worked to maintain the high standards of previous years, and to expand the magazine in new directions. Flash is a student produced publication which relies on submissions of fiction, poetry, art, and photographs from the student body. This year many improvements were made in the areas of layout, selection, and publication, and this enhanced the magazine, providing a far more cohesive final product. Flash is a reflection of the creative element of the Upper School. 1. Bob Piper puls a cover on the rack to dry. 2. Forum faces issues Co-chairpersons: Maria Eggemeyer Jeff Kling Secretary: Ellen Lieberman Treasurer: Chris Maxson Representatives: Richard Donaldson Mike Hatfield Grier Arthur Amy Schachtman Tyler Philips Eric Feinberg Faculty: Bill Sherfey Arturo Steely Norma Thomson Ilona Rouda Dan Danielson The 1987-88 Upper School Forum was chaired by Jeff Kling and Maria Eggemeyer. The group of five faculty members and nine students met weekly to discuss issues concerning the Upper School community. The Forum was especially effective in its crackdown on clubs which forced them to be more active. Also, Forum established the B.E.A.R. club which helped improve the atmosphere of the school during construction. A major Forum project was planning a program to provide Blake students with volunteer opportunities. 1 Jeff Kling explains the Forum caucus procedure to freshman representative Tyler Phillips. 2 Norma Thomson and John Stander show interest in the topic of the Thursday morning Forum meeting 3 When Jeff Kling speaks, everyone listens. 22 — Forum
